    U.S. Marine Cpl. Matthew Miller, a combat engineer with Combat Engineer Platoon, Task Force Koa Moana 16-4, swings at a baseball during Croix Du Sud in Plum, New Caledonia, Nov. 6, 2016. Croix Du Sud is a multi-national, humanitarian assistance disaster relief and non-combatant evacuation operation exercise conducted every two years to prepare nations in the event of a cyclone in the South Pacific. The Koa Moana exercise seeks to enhance senior military leader engagements between allied and partner nations in the Pacific with a collective interest in military-to-military relations.
